AI Summary

  • Caps noneconomic damages in civil actions at a dollar amount to be specified (left blank in the bill text)

  • Defines noneconomic damages to include physical pain and suffering, mental/emotional anguish, loss of consortium, disfigurement, physical impairment, loss of companionship, inconvenience, loss of enjoyment of life, and injury to reputation

  • Excludes punitive damages from the noneconomic damages cap

  • Requires voter approval of a constitutional amendment repealing Article II, Section 31 and Article XVIII, Section 6 of the Arizona Constitution before the law can take effect

  • Sponsored by Representatives Antenori, Gowan, Burges, Kavanagh, and Stevens in the 2010 legislative session
